1. Understand Type Synergy and Coverage
One of the most important things to consider when assembling your team is type synergy. Different Pokemon types have strengths and weaknesses, and understanding these interactions can give you a major advantage in battles. For example, Water-type Pokemon are strong against Fire-types but weak against Electric-types.
To build a well-rounded team, try to include Pokemon with different types to ensure that you have coverage against various opponents. For instance, pairing a Fire-type with a Water-type can help you handle most scenarios without being overly vulnerable to one specific type. Always be mindful of the type matchups and make sure you have Pokemon that complement each other.
2. Balance Offensive and Defensive Capabilities
While it’s tempting to stack your team with strong attackers, defense plays an equally crucial role in Pokemon Legends: Z-A. A balanced team with both offensive and defensive Pokemon will give you more flexibility during battles. Some Pokemon can function as tanks, absorbing damage while allowing your attackers to deal heavy hits.
Consider including at least one or two Pokemon with good defensive stats or support moves like status conditions (e.g., Paralysis, Sleep, etc.) or healing moves (like Wish or Recover). This will allow your team to outlast the enemy and control the tempo of the battle. Don’t neglect defensive strategies, as they can often turn the tide of a tough fight.

4. Take Advantage of Move Set Customization
Every Pokemon Legends: Z-A player knows that the right move set can make or break a battle. It’s important to diversify your Pokemon's moves so they have multiple strategies to choose from. For example, having a mix of offensive moves, status-inflicting moves, and supportive moves can help your team adapt to any opponent.

5. Focus on EV Training and IV Optimization
Efficiently training your Pokemon’s stats is crucial if you want to maximize their potential. In Pokemon Legends: Z-A, EV training (Effort Values) and IVs (Individual Values) play a major role in determining your Pokemon's performance in battle. EVs determine how your Pokemon’s stats increase as they level up, and IVs define their inherent potential in each stat.
By focusing on the right EV training and optimizing your Pokemon’s IVs, you can create monsters that are not only powerful but also tailored to your playstyle. It might take some time and effort, but the payoff is well worth it.
